Zarafshon, known as the 'Gold Capital of Uzbekistan', plays a pivotal role in the country's mining industry. The city's economy is heavily reliant on mining, particularly gold extraction, which is a significant contributor to local employment. In 2024, Zarafshon is expected to see steady job growth, driven by investments in mining technology and infrastructure projects aimed at enhancing production efficiency. Emerging sectors such as renewable energy and agriculture are also gaining traction, offering new employment opportunities.

Zarafshon is experiencing a steady increase in employment opportunities, particularly in the mining and energy sectors. The city's job market is characterized by a low turnover rate, reflecting stable employment conditions. Income inequality remains a challenge, with efforts underway to provide more equitable job opportunities across different sectors.
Remote work is gradually gaining acceptance in Zarafshon, especially in sectors like IT and marketing. Local companies are beginning to offer remote positions, although the trend is not as widespread as in larger cities. Nationally, remote work continues to grow, with 35% of workers in Uzbekistan engaging in some form of remote work in 2024.
